Weather:

The weather on Jupiter, like everything else about a planet is large. Storms that grow to cover thousands of ( km) within hours, winds shipping the clouds at 360 kph, and storms that last for hundreds of years are typical.

water:

Jupiter has some water vapor in its atmosphere, but the amount is negligible. On Jupiter;s moon Eurropa, much water is presental in the form of ice, Underneath the smooth surface of europa, could be and ocean of liquid water.
